Featured Webinar: Why Your Annual MVR Strategy is a Legal Time Bomb (And How to Defuse It)
Why Your Annual MVR Strategy is a Legal Time Bomb (And How to Defuse It)
View the recording to hear from SambaSafety's Vice President, Product Management, Amy Wilson and General Counsel, Chief Compliance Officer, John Diana, as they discuss why solely relying on an annual MVR strategy creates dangerous visibility gaps which can cost your organization millions. Additionally, Amy and John explore:
- The new standard of care expected from fleet operators in 2025
- 4 critical strategies that close visibility gaps and strengthen legal defenses
- How to position safety technology as employee development, not surveillance

Featured Content: 2025 Telematics Report
Report Finds Driver Safety Powers Telematics Adoption
The 2025 Telematics Report offers the most comprehensive view into telematics trends impacting P&C insurers, brokers and fleets. This report provides new data and insights into the current state of telematics, covering utilization, impact and investment trends across insurance teams and various fleet segments.
Key findings in the report include:
- 66% of fleets cite interpreting or acting on telematics data as a challenge
- 70% of fleets use two or more device types to manage safety
- 80% of the top 50 commercial insurers use telematics data, yet only 4% consider their programs advanced
- Of fleets that share telematics data, 65% do so to secure better rates, while 60% are motivated by active risk management support from their insurer
- 88% of fleets now use telematics for safety, but only 30% share data with insurers
